Khabib Nurmagomedov burns Conor McGregor on social media

Tom Taylor - January 24, 2020

Shortly after Conor McGregor stopped Donald Cerrone in the welterweight main event of UFC 246, he proudly proclaimed himself the first UFC fighter to pick up knockout wins at welterweight, lightweight and featherweight. McGregor’s arch rival Khabib Nurmagomedov wants to remind him of another multi-divisional feat. Using an image posted to Twitter, Nurmagomedov not-so-subtly reminded fight fans that McGregor has also been submitted in three weight classes. The Irishman tapped out to Nate Diaz at welterweight, to Nurmagomedov at lightweight, and to Joe Duffy at featherweight.

VIDEO | Watch Conor McGregor train shoulder strikes years before ‘Cowboy’ fight

Adam Martin - January 23, 2020

Footage has been released of UFC superstar Conor McGregor training shoulder strikes with former UFC fighter Cathal Pendred years ago. McGregor used shoulder strikes in his main event fight at UFC 246 against Donald Cerrone in the bout’s opening seconds and badly hurt “Cowboy” with them. After kicking Cerrone right in the chin with a high kick, McGregor was able to pummel Cerrone with punches on the mat and finish him for a 40-second TKO win in his long-awaited return to the Octagon.

Team Khabib Nurmagomedov promises special rules fight with Floyd Mayweather

Tom Taylor - January 23, 2020

UFC lightweight champ Khabib Nurmagomedov and his team are currently focused on a lightweight title fight with top contender Tony Ferguson, but once that’s over, they’re hoping for a fight with undefeated boxing legend Floyd Mayweather Jr. According to the Nurmagomedov patriarch Abdulmanap, the hope is for a special rules bout with Mayweather: 11 rounds contested under boxing rules, and a lone, 12th round contested under the full MMA rule-set.

Thiago Alves explains decision to sign with BKFC

Tom Taylor - January 23, 2020

After 14 years and 27 fights with the UFC, Thiago Alves found himself longing for a fresh start. So, when the promotion offered him a new deal after a pair of losses to Laureano Staropoli and Tim Means, he respectfully declined, and signed an exclusive contract with upstart bare knuckle promotion Bare Knuckle Fighting Championship (BKFC) instead. “I’ve been in MMA for such a long time, I’ve been with the UFC for such a long time,” Alves told BJPENN.com hours after his signing with BKFC was announced. “I’m excited for a new stage. Anything new at this stage in my life is super exciting. I’ve been following BKFC for a little bit now, and I think it’s savage.

Cris Cyborg looks to etch her legacy in stone in Bellator debut

Mike Pendleton - January 23, 2020

At Bellator 238, on Saturday, January 25, Cris Cyborg will challenge Julia Budd for the Bellator featherweight title. When she steps into the Bellator cage for the first time, Cyborg will be adding another world-class MMA promotion to her resume, which already includes the UFC, Invicta FC, and Strikeforce. She will also be re-uniting with her old boss, Scott Coker. Much was made about the relationship between Cyborg and UFC President Dana White as the two were at odds for several years, and didn’t seem to see eye-to-eye when she was with the company. While the UFC was certainly the biggest stage for Cyborg’s global brand, she had already cemented herself as one of the greatest fighters of all-time, and working with a familiar face in Coker should also come with a breath of fresh air.
